Jungkook debuted as a solo artist apart from BTS with “Seven”. Photo: Rachana LR/BIGHIT
jungkook He is the last member of BTS to enter the K-pop industry as a solo artist. Although the South Korean singer had previously premiered songs such as “Left and Right” without his bandmates, this did not mark his official solo debut. Thus, the popular ‘JK’ started a new phase in his career after the K-pop septet’s group break due to the conscription of its members into compulsory military service with the official launch of Sensilo “Seven” and more songs: “My You” and “Still With You”,
On July 2 (hours in South Korea), BIGHIT Record Company confirmed that the songs “My You” and “Still With You” by Jungkook. They will be part of her debut album En Solitario. It is to be noted that both the pieces of music were dedicated by the artist to their fanclubs at the birthday celebrations of the group in the past and were published on SoundCloud.
When will “My You” and “Still With You” be released?
While the BTS member’s lead single, “Seven,” will premiere on July 14, the songs “My You” and “Still With You” will be officially released on July 3. 1.00 p.m. (KST).
